Otsoko (Wolf)
Performed by Gaitzerdi Teatro (Spain, Basque Country)
The celebrated Bilbao-based physical dance theatre company present a mature and powerful retelling of the traditional Red Riding Hood tale. Taking the darkest aspects of the famous story, Otsoko (Wolf) brilliantly dissects the complex relationship between a wolf and a young woman. With a menacing forest made of sticks, flowers made from darts, fire effects and a genuinely frightening pack of wolves with illuminated spines, this is the Angela Carter school of disturbing fairytales.
Performed with English narration, suitable for audiences aged 10+, floor seating.
